EditPlaceInfoViewController
final class EditPlaceInfoViewController : UIViewController
extension EditPlaceInfoViewController: EditPlaceInfoProtocol
extension EditPlaceInfoViewController: UIGestureRecognizerDelegate
-
Declaration
Swift
lazy var presenter: EditPlaceInfoPresenter { get set }
-
Declaration
Swift
override func viewDidLoad()
-
Declaration
Swift
override func viewWillAppear(_ animated: Bool)
-
Declaration
Swift
override func viewWillDisappear(_ animated: Bool)
-
Declaration
Swift
func setupLayout()
-
Declaration
Swift
func setupAttribute()
-
Declaration
Swift
func setupBlurEffect()
-
Declaration
Swift
func setupGesture()
-
Declaration
Swift
func whenViewWillAppearSelectedIndex(_ index: Int)
-
Declaration
Swift
func handleClosure()
-
Declaration
Swift
func isDetailFieldCheckBeforeKeyboardShowAndHide(notification: NSNotification) -> Bool
-
Declaration
Swift
func keyboardWillShow(height: CGFloat)
-
Declaration
Swift
func keyboardWillHide()
-
Declaration
Swift
func dataBindingLocation(title: String, category: String, marker: NMFMarker, address: String, address2: String )
-
Declaration
Swift
func dataBindingPhone(phone: String)
-
Declaration
Swift
func dataBindingOperatingHours(operatingHourModels: [EditOperationHoursModel])
-
Declaration
Swift
func dataBindingHomepage(homepage: String)
-
Declaration
Swift
func pushAddressEditViewController(placeMarkerModel: MarkerModel)
-
Declaration
Swift
func updateNaverMap(_ latLng: NMGLatLng)
-
Declaration
Swift
func editStoreButtonChangeableState(_ state: Bool)
-
Declaration
Swift
func popViewController()
-
Declaration
Swift
func showErrorAlert(with error: String, title: String? = nil)
-
Declaration
Swift
func gestureRecognizer(_ gestureRecognizer: UIGestureRecognizer, shouldReceive touch: UITouch) -> Bool